Mackay WhitsundayOver the past decade, the Mackay Whitsunday region has experienced unprecedented economic growth which has been predominantly fuelled by global demand for resources. Expanding capability in servicing and value-added processing has driven specialisation in mining services and engineering. A growing marine industry servicing boats and yachts has developed, stimulated by the region's premium marine location. The region also boasts strong agricultural potential, from diversification and food processing to the use of fibre to produce renewable fuels and bio-commodities. The region has identified mining services and technologies and marine services as the two sectoral areas for initial development under the Centres of Enterprise initiative.
